Asbestosis

Fibre inhalation

Asbestosis is caused by the inhalation of asbestos fibres. Diagnosis is made on the basis of clinical features, X-ray appearances and a history of exposure to asbestos. Our legal team are specialists in ensuring that our clients and their loved ones receive the maximum compensation possible.
